– Step by Step -- How to fix the sticky joystick on Nintendo Switch Lite

  • Turn off your Nintendo Switch Lite before you start working on the sticky joystick.
  • Use a soft toothbrush or cotton swab and isopropyl alcohol to clean around the joystick and inside the base.
  • Gently remove any residue or dirt that may be causing the joystick to feel sticky.
  • Repeat this process on both joysticks to make sure they are both clean and free of dirt.
  • Once you have cleaned the joysticks, let the alcohol dry completely before turning on your Nintendo Switch Lite again.
  • If the problem persists, you may need calibrate the joysticks in your console settings. This option is found in the settings menu.
  • If none of these solutions solve the problem, you may need contact Nintendo customer service to get additional assistance.

1. What is the cause of the sticky joystick on the Nintendo Switch Lite?

  1. The dust and dirt that accumulates with daily use.
  2. The natural wear and tear of the joystick material.
  3. The accumulation of food or drink residue.

2. What materials do I need to fix the sticky joystick?

  1. A small crosshead screwdriver.
  2. An electronic contact cleaner spray.
  3. Isopropyl alcohol.
  4. cotton swabs
  5. A clean soft cloth.

3. What is the step by step procedure to clean the sticky joystick of Nintendo Switch Lite?

  1. Turn off your Nintendo Switch Lite and disconnect it from the charger.
  2. Remove the rubber bands from the joysticks carefully.
  3. Unscrew the screws holding the console casing.
  4. Carefully remove the case to expose the joysticks.
  5. Apply electronic contact cleaner spray to the joysticks.
  6. Clean the joysticks with isopropyl alcohol and cotton swabs.
  7. Let it dry completely before reassembling the console.

4. What should I keep in mind when disassembling the console to fix the sticky joystick?

  1. Work in a clean, well-lit area.
  2. Be careful with static to avoid damaging electronic components.
  3. Remember the location of each screw when disassembling to facilitate subsequent assembly.

7. How can I prevent the Nintendo Switch Lite joystick from becoming sticky?

  1. Regularly clean the joysticks with isopropyl alcohol and cotton swabs.
  2. Keep the console away from sources of dirt, food or liquids that could cause damage.
  3. Use silicone protectors for the joysticks to prevent the accumulation of dirt.

8. How long does it take to fix the sticky Nintendo Switch Lite joystick?

  1. The disassembly, cleaning and drying process can take around 30-45 minutes.
  2. It is important to wait for the console to be completely dry before reassembling it to avoid damage.
